Mary Rachel GAVIN was born in 1751 in Duplin, Sampson, NC USA, the child of Thomas I Gavin And Mary Sloan. Mary Rachel GAVIN married John Carroll, and had children including Joseph Carroll. Mary Rachel GAVIN passed away in 1811 in Duplin, Sampson, NC USA.
